Auburn native Colin Britt conducts a rehearsal Friday for the District 2 Honors Vocal Festival at Edward Little High School in Auburn. Over 330 students from Cumberland, Androscoggin and Oxford counties will perform Saturday during the festival, which consists of three choirs. Doors open at 2:15 p.m. Tickets are $5 for adults. Students can attend for free. Britt graduated from ELHS in 2003, received his master’s degree from the Yale School of Music in New Haven, Connecticut, and teaches at Mount Holyoke College in South Hadley, Massachusetts.
